KVM: Export KVM-internal symbols for sub-modules only
Rework the vast majority of KVM's exports to expose symbols only to KVM submodules, i.e. to x86's kvm-{amd,intel}.ko and PPC's kvm-{pr,hv}.ko. With few exceptions, KVM's exported APIs are intended (and safe) for KVM- internal usage only. Keep kvm_get_kvm(), kvm_get_kvm_safe(), and kvm_put_kvm() as normal exports, as they are needed by VFIO, and are generally safe for external usage (though ideally even the get/put APIs would be KVM-internal, and VFIO would pin a VM by grabbing a reference to its associated file). Implement a framework in kvm_types.h in anticipation of providing a macro to restrict KVM-specific kernel exports, i.e. to provide symbol exports for KVM if and only if KVM is built as one or more modules.
